Police responded to a parking garage to investigate a hit and run traffic crash. When the officer’s came into contact with our client, they claimed that his breath smelled of alcohol and that his eyes were bloodshot. Our client refused to perform field sobriety exercises and did not provide a breath sample, so he was arrested for DUI. The lawyers at the ticket clinic prepared the case and, on the day of trial, all DUI related charges were dropped.

Rolando A. Sanchez, Esq.

Originally from Miami , grew up in Central Florida.  After high school, he joined the U.S. Air Force where he worked on F-15E fighter jets as an Avionics Technician.  He was Honorably Discharged. Afterwards, he attended University of Central Florida and received a BSBA Finance Degree, cum laude.  Next, he attended Barry University for law school and among other things, served as V.P. of the Veterans Legal Society.  Since graduating in 2016, Mr. Sanchez has dedicated his career to helping those charged with criminal matters.  These cases include traffic, misdemeanors and felonies, including trials and post-conviction relief. Mr. Sanchez is the lead attorney in Ticket Clinic’s Kissimmee office, handling cases in Osceola, Polk, Hardee and Desoto Counties.
